Dr. Rob Beadling is a Lecturer in Mechanical Engineering at the School of Mechanical Engineering, University of Leeds, Faculty of Engineering and Physical Sciences. His research focuses on tribology, corrosion, and biomaterials, with applications in total joint replacement.
His research interests include:
- Tribology and wear mechanisms in biomedical implants
- Corrosion behavior of engineering materials
- Surface functionalization and engineering for improved performance
- Biomaterials for orthopedic applications
His work is associated with the Institute of Functional Surfaces, a leading research group in surface engineering and tribology. He currently supervises postgraduate researchers, including Rob Elkington. Dr. Beadling holds a PhD and MEng (Hons) in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Leeds and is a professional member of IOM3, IMechE, and NACE.
